Dubai Customs launches “Masar” program for better strategic planning and corporate performance
Dubai – 21 November 2018: Within its efforts to upgrade corporate performance and operations, Dubai Customs launched “Masar Strategic Planning and Corporate Performance Program” which is expected to help automate operational plans and KPI’s for all units in the Department.
The launch took place in the presence of Ahmed Mahboob Musabih, Director of Dubai Customs, Juma Al Ghaith, Executive Director of Customs Development Division at Dubai Customs, Abdullah Al Khaja, Executive Director of Customer Management Division, Farid Hassan Al Marzouqi, Executive Director, Human Resources, Finance and Administration Division, Ahmed Abdul Salam Kazim, Director of Strategy and Corporate Excellence, and directors and managers of Dubai Customs departments and customs centers.
“Maintaining the leading international position and developing it for Dubai Customs is part of our vision. With this in mind, we embarked on a number of leading projects and initiatives in customs field following world-class standards and practices. Masar also comes in support of Dubai government policies and Dubai Plan 2021. It is a smart system that provides us with a holistic view to all the Department’s achievements and contributions towards the UAE Centennial 2071 and Dubai Plan 2021”.
On her part, Shamsa Al Raisi, Manager of Strategy Section at the Strategy and Corporate Excellence Department pointed out Masar will improve performance by providing updated and necessary information and timely alerts.
